Job DescriptionCOMPANY OVERVIEW Westcore is a fully-integrated commercial real estate investment company with institutional scale and capabilities that operates with the speed and adaptability of opportunistic entrepreneurs. Westcore has a dynamic track record of real estate investing going back to its founding in 2000. We focus on well-located industrial properties in the United States. We are a vertically integrated company with expertise in all facets of real estate investment management: acquisitions, finance, asset management, leasing, construction, and building operations. To better support our overall company and the anticipated doubling of our portfolio over the next few years, Westcore is looking for a skilled Senior Business Intelligence Analyst. POSITION SUMMARY: This role is responsible for architecting and implementing the company's next-generation business intelligence and data analytics platform. The position requires a seasoned analytics professional who combines deep technical expertise with strong business acumen to translate commercial real estate operations into data-driven insights. The successful candidate will lead the development of Microsoft Fabric/OneLake infrastructure, build scalable data pipelines integrating multiple CRE data sources, and create sophisticated reporting solutions that address the specific needs of asset management, leasing, and finance teams. This role demands someone who understands CRE business metrics - from NOI and occupancy rates to lease expirations and capital planning and can design analytics frameworks that drive strategic decision-making. As a forward-thinking technology advocate, this individual will establish robust data infrastructure supporting current BI needs while championing and preparing for future AI-enabled capabilities, including natural language data exploration. The ideal candidate brings 5+ years of analytics experience, preferably in commercial real estate or related industries, with proven expertise in Power BI, SQL, Python, and enterprise data architecture. CORE 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IES: • Design and maintain a centralized enterprise data platform (Microsoft Fabric/OneLake or equivalent) with scalable pipelines integrating key CRE systems such as Yardi, Argus, CoStar, and GreenStreet., • Develop unified data models and implement governance, quality, and documentation standards to ensure data accuracy, consistency, and accessibility., • Translate complex business requirements into analytical solutions by partnering with stakeholders across asset management, leasing, and finance to identify needs, define KPIs, and design reporting frameworks., • Build and maintain sophisticated Power BI dashboards and reporting solutions that deliver actionable insights aligned with CRE industry best practices and operational needs., • Create automated data workflows and reporting processes using Power Automate and Python scripting to improve efficiency and data reliability., • Champion AI and emerging technology adoption by staying current with industry trends, proactively identifying opportunities to enhance analytics capabilities, and positioning data architecture for future AI integration including natural language interaction., • Promote data literacy and adoption by training users, advancing BI tool utilization, and fostering a culture of data-driven decision-making.
